The Light Efficient Design LED-8130M50CD is purpose-built for industrial retrofits where maximum efficiency and minimal downtime are priorities. This 150W open rated high bay retrofit is engineered to directly replace lamps up to 400W HID — including metal halide and high-pressure sodium — using the standard EX39 mogul screw base. The plug-and-play installation eliminates the need for fixture replacements or electrical modifications, making it the ideal solution for large-scale lighting upgrades in Canadian warehouses, factories, and distribution centres.
Electrical compatibility is a key strength of this retrofit. With a wide input voltage range of 120-277V AC, the LED-8130M50CD adapts to virtually any existing high bay electrical infrastructure found in North American commercial and industrial buildings. This flexibility reduces installation complexity and ensures the lamp performs reliably whether connected to single-phase or three-phase electrical panels without additional transformers or drivers.
The 5000K colour temperature delivers a bright, daylight-quality light that enhances visual acuity and worker productivity in high-ceiling environments. Crisp, neutral white illumination reduces eye fatigue over long shifts and improves colour rendering across inventory, machinery, and workspaces — a critical factor in manufacturing, logistics, and inspection applications where visibility directly impacts operational performance.
The open rated designation of this fixture means it is certified for use in open luminaire configurations — a common requirement in high bay applications where enclosed housings are not used. This rating ensures safe, code-compliant operation in a wide range of commercial and industrial settings, including those subject to Canadian electrical standards and building codes. Facilities managers can confidently deploy these lamps knowing they meet the necessary safety and performance criteria.
Beyond energy savings, the LED-8130M50CD dramatically reduces maintenance demands. LED technology offers a significantly longer operational lifespan compared to HID sources, meaning fewer lamp replacements and less downtime associated with re-lamping at height. For large facilities with dozens or hundreds of high bay fixtures, the cumulative reduction in labour and material costs represents a compelling return on investment alongside the immediate electricity savings.
